PRP Treatment for Hair Restoration: Revitalize Your Crown restore
Are you struggling with thinning hair or hair loss? PRP treatment may be the solution you've been searching for. This cutting-edge treatment utilizes your own blood to stimulate growth, effectively encouraging natural hair revival. PRP involves drawing a small amount of blood, processing it in a centrifuge to concentrate the platelet-rich plasma, and then injecting this potent cocktail into your scalp. This targeted delivery triggers a cascade of healing responses that improve hair thickness.
The benefits of PRP for hair restoration are numerous. It's a safe, organic treatment with minimal downtime and complications. Many patients experience noticeable improvements in appearance within just a few sessions.
- Consider PRP if you're experiencing:
- Androgenetic alopecia (male or female pattern baldness)
- Hair loss due to stress
- Scarring alopecia

Understanding Male Pattern Baldness and Effective Treatments
Male pattern baldness, also often referred to as androgenetic alopecia, is a condition that affects many men as they age. It's characterized by progressive hair loss on the crown and temples, often leading to a receding hairline. This takes place due to a combination of genetic predisposition and hormonal influences. A variety of factors can contribute to male pattern baldness, including:
- Genetics
- Age
- Androgens
Fortunately, there are effective treatments available to manage male pattern baldness.
These include:
* Medications like minoxidil (Rogaine) and finasteride (Propecia), which can promote hair growth and slow down hair loss.
* Follicular unit extraction, a more invasive procedure that involves transplanting hair follicles from one area of the scalp to the balding area.

Two of the most promising breakthroughs are Platelet-Rich Plasma more info (PRP) therapy and Scalp Micropigmentation (SMP).
PRP therapy involves injecting a concentrate of platelets derived from your own blood into the scalp. These platelets contain healing factors that stimulate follicle growth, potentially leading to thicker, fuller hair. SMP, on the other hand, is a cosmetic procedure that uses tiny pigments to create the illusion of a shaved head or a fuller hair appearance.
